S. Dillon Ripley Center

A round building with large windows, stone columns, and a domed roof.

Named after the Smithsonian's 8th Secretary, the underground building's copper domed entrance is on Jefferson Drive between the "Castle" and the Freer Gallery of the National Museum of Asian Art.
